About the role
Drake Medox is seeking fun, enthusiastic and hard‐working support workers within the Burwood area.
Our client, living at home with a Spinal Cord Injury – C4 Quadriplegic, is seeking support workers to join their dynamic team on an on‐going basis.
This is a great opportunity for you to make a difference in our client's life, as well as enhance your skills and knowledge with ongoing client‐specific training.
Our client is seeking someone who has a genuine love of gardening with previous spinal injuries experience; you must have excellent communication and engagement skills.
The right candidate will be versatile and available to work every Mon‐Wed, 7:30‐3:00PM and from Wed‐Sat,



3:00‐8:00 or 9:00PM with any more available shifts as backup and on weekends.
Your key responsibilities
Personal care
Medication administration
Domestic assistance
Bowel Care management
Full supervision of the client
Pressure area management
Work with the client and assist with personal care and manual handling
Assisting and supporting the client in the home and out in the community
About you
Previous disability experience (minimum 2 years)
Minimum Cert III in Disability or other relevant qualifications
Manual handling experience (essential)Current accredited First aid and CPR
Yellow card/NDIS Screening Card
Manual handling certificate (or willing to obtain)
Medication certificate (or willing to obtain)
Right to live and work within Australia
Valid Australian Driver's License
NDIS worker screener check
We are also looking for someone with great communication skills, who works well in a team, has a caring and supportive nature, and is client focused.
